In this comparison, both of the tyres are made by a brand from USA. BFGoodrich is a brand that belongs to the Michelin group. Uniroyal is a brand that belongs to the Michelin group. Generally, BFGoodrich winter tyres are slightly better rated (75%) than Uniroyal (69%). But when it comes to comparing BFGoodrich ACTIVAN WINTER and Uniroyal SNOW MAX 2, the rating is the same - 0%. Important for this comparison is also the ADAC 2019 205/65 R16 test, where both the ACTIVAN WINTER and the SNOW MAX 2 were tested.
